Conclusion Meanings:

'Exonerated': or 'Within NYPD Guidelines' - The conduct occurred but did not violate the NYPD's own rules, which often give officers significant discretion.
'Unfounded': Evidence suggests that the event or alleged conduct did not occur.
'Unsubstantiated': or 'Unable to Determine' - The alleged conduct was investigated but could not determine both that the conduct occurred and that it broke the rules.

Lawsuits

Named in 4 known lawsuits, $95,000 total settlements.

Rosario, Madia L., et al. vs City of New York, et al.
Case # 158457/2013, Supreme Court - New York, September 24, 2013
Complaint
Description: On August 24, 2012, Plaintiff was standing in the crosswalk at the corner of a street, when she was shot by a bullet fired from the gun of either Defendant NYPD PO Craig Matthews or PO Robert Sinishtaj. The police officers were responding to an incident in the vicinity, and failed to follow and exercise proper police tactics and procedures during the incident, giving rise to the injuries sustained by Plaintiff.

Duclos, Chenin vs City of New York
Case # 150593/2013, Supreme Court - New York, January 23, 2013
Complaint
Description: On or about September 5, 2012, Plaintiff was on the streets when she was shot by a bullet fired from the gun of either Defendant NYPD PO Craig Matthews or PO Robert Sinishtaj. The officers were responding to an incident involving an alleged perpetrator. However, the defendant police officers were negligent in failing to properly follow and/or employ proper police procedure and tactics, which resulted in Plaintiff's injuries.
